2003 is the 50th Anniversary of the Coronation of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II. The celebrate this event, the Royal Canadian Mint has produced a 1953 Special Edition Coronation Set. This set is inspired by the coins used in 1953. The obverse features the young portrait of the Queen from 1953, as well as double-dating on the obverse.
The reverse features designs from that era as well, including the 12-sided nickel, old 50ct design and..... the popular Voyageur Silver Dollar!!!! The coins are struck in proof sterling silver, except the silver dollar (which is struck in .9999 pure silver!), and the 1ct (which is struck in copper).
